Researchers have developed a spectral clustering algorithm capable of exactly recovering communities in bipartite networks. This algorithm, based on the diagonal-deleted Gram matrix, provides theoretical guarantees for exact recovery under mild conditions, even with unbalanced community sizes or heterogeneous degrees. The method is also effective for degree-corrected stochastic co-blockmodels, maintaining its recovery guarantee with a row-normalized version of the algorithm. Experimental results confirm the theoretical findings. AI
